The 'Blizzflosser' by Chris Martin Gently Flosses in Seconds

The process of flossing is notoriously tedious and requires several minutes to be performed, which are two aspects the 'Blizzflosser' is designed to help change. Designed by Chris Martin, the oral care device is achieved via 3D printing and utilizes several small sections of floss to clear plaque in mere seconds. The mouthpiece only needs to be positioned into the mouth and shifted with the jaw to fit the various floss pieces in between the teeth; moving the unit around for about 15-seconds will result in all teeth being flossed at once with minimal effort.

The 'Blizzflosser' is designed to perfectly replicate the process of manual flossing and is rated to last for up to three-months of regular use. The unit only needs to be rinsed between uses to keep it fresh.
